Long-term health conditions and the need for help with everyday activities.
More people in postcode 4503 now need help with daily activities than in 2011. This area sees a higher rate of mental health conditions than most similar places, with 12.2% of residents reporting one.
Long-term conditions people report.
Mental health conditions are the most common long-term health issue here, affecting 12.2% of people, which is well above the national figure of 8.8%. Overall, 30.6% of residents have a long-term health condition, a little above the Queensland average.

People needing help with daily activities.
Need for help with daily activities has risen by 1.5 percentage points since 2011 to reach 6.0%. This is higher than most other areas, although it is about the same as the state and national figures.
